Full Jewish relationship chart

Grandparents

Father's father

Zayde

Yiddish; Hebrew equivalent: Saba. No separate word for paternal vs maternal.

Father's mother

Bubbe

Hebrew: Savta

Mother's father

Zayde

Mother's mother

Bubbe

Parents & Their Siblings

Father

Tate

Hebrew: Abba

Mother

Mame

Hebrew: Ima

Father's older brother

Feter

Hebrew: Dod. Yiddish doesn't distinguish an uncle by side of the family or by age.

Father's younger brother

Feter

Father's sister

Tante

Hebrew: Doda

Mother's older brother

Feter

Mother's younger brother

Feter

Mother's sister

Tante

Father's older brother's wife

Tante

Father's younger brother's wife

Tante

Mother's brother's wife

Tante

Father's sister's husband

Feter

Mother's sister's husband

Feter

Siblings & Cousins

Older brother

Bruder

No separate word by age.

Younger brother

Bruder

Older sister

Shvester

Younger sister

Shvester

Father's brother's son

Kuzin

Hebrew: Ben-dod ('son of uncle') / Bat-dod ('daughter of uncle'); no distinction by side of the family.

Father's brother's daughter

Kuzine

Father's sister's son

Kuzin

Father's sister's daughter

Kuzine

Mother's brother's son

Kuzin

Mother's brother's daughter

Kuzine

Mother's sister's son

Kuzin

Mother's sister's daughter

Kuzine

Children, Grandchildren & Their Spouses

Son

Zun

Hebrew: Ben

Daughter

Tochter

Hebrew: Bat

Grandson

Eynikl

Same word covers a grandson or granddaughter in Yiddish; Hebrew distinguishes Neched/Nechda.

Granddaughter

Eynikl

Son-in-law

Eydem

Hebrew: Chatan

Daughter-in-law

Shnur

Hebrew: Kala

Brother's son

Plimenik

Sister's son

Plimenik

Brother's daughter

Plimenitse

Sister's daughter

Plimenitse

Spouse & In-Laws

Husband

Man

Hebrew: Ba'al

Wife

Vayb

Hebrew: Isha

Spouse's father

Shver

Spouse's mother

Shviger

Husband's older brother

Shvoger

Husband's younger brother

Shvoger

Husband's sister

Shvegerin

Wife's brother

Shvoger

Wife's sister

Shvegerin

Brother's wife

Shvegerin

Sister's husband

Shvoger
